Australian slots, commonly known as pokies, hold a significant place in the gambling landscape of the nation. These gaming machines are not just a staple in every pub and casino but are deeply woven into the cultural fabric of Australia. Despite a decline in overall gambling participation since 2019, pokies remain a vital revenue generator and a popular leisure activity for many Australians.
The allure of Australian slots lies in their accessibility and variety. Pokies encompass a range of games, from classic three-reel slots to modern video slots with immersive graphics and storylines. Their availability in both physical and digital formats also contributes to their sustained popularity.
The Interactive Gambling Act 2001 plays a pivotal role in shaping the legal environment for Australian slots, particularly online pokies. This legislation restricts the provision of online gambling services to Australian residents by local operators, although it does not prevent Australians from accessing offshore sites. This regulatory gap raises concerns over enforcement and player protection.
Each Australian state and territory has its regulatory body overseeing the operation and licensing of pokies. For instance, while some states implement strict wagering limits and machine numbers per venue, others, like major casinos, might enjoy certain exemptions. Harm minimization strategies, such as mandatory information displays and self-exclusion programs, are common measures across various jurisdictions.
The pokies industry in Australia represents a complex blend of tradition and modernity. With over 200,000 gaming machines, the country holds one of the highest numbers of pokies per capita globally. Although traditional venues remain popular, there is a marked shift toward online platforms.
Projected to see continual growth, the online Australian slots market benefits from technological advancements, regulatory adjustments, and consumer demand for convenient gambling options.

Australian slots range from classic slots, which are traditional three-reel machines, to video slots that feature advanced technology with graphics and sound. Progressive jackpot slots offer growing jackpots and are highly sought after by players for their potential high rewards.
In Australia, online pokies offered by locally licensed operators are limited due to the Interactive Gambling Act 2001. This compels many Australians to resort to offshore platforms, which are rife with legal and security concerns due to minimal player protections.
Technological growth is a major force transforming the pokies industry, making games more accessible and engaging. The rise of mobile internet and smartphone usage facilitates the proliferation of online slots, with future prospects involving augmented reality features and blockchain integration for enhanced transparency.
